Understanding Creatine Forms
Creatine monohydrate remains the gold standard with the most research support and proven effectiveness. Alternative forms like creatine HCL, Kre-Alkalyn, and ethyl ester exist, but none have demonstrated superior results in scientific studies. Monohydrate is also the most cost-effective form, giving you more creatine per dollar spent.
Micronized creatine monohydrate is simply standard monohydrate processed into finer particles. This improves dissolution in water and may enhance absorption slightly. For most users, the difference is marginal, but the improved mixability alone justifies choosing micronized when prices are comparable.
Third-Party Testing Importance
Supplement quality varies significantly between brands. Third-party testing from NSF, Informed Sport, or similar organizations verifies that products contain exactly what labels claim without contamination. This matters most for competitive athletes subject to drug testing, but quality-conscious consumers benefit from the assurance as well.
NSF Certified for Sport is the most rigorous standard, testing for over 300 banned substances. Informed Sport and cGMP certifications provide additional quality verification. Budget products often skip these certifications to reduce costs, which is acceptable for casual users but risky for competitors.
Loading Phase vs Maintenance Dosing
The traditional loading phase involves taking 20g of creatine daily for 5-7 days to saturate muscle stores quickly. This produces faster initial results but causes more water retention and potential stomach discomfort. A maintenance dose of 5g daily achieves the same saturation within 3-4 weeks with fewer side effects.
Research confirms that both approaches lead to identical long-term results. The choice depends on your timeline and tolerance for temporary bloating. Women and smaller individuals may prefer skipping the loading phase to minimize water weight fluctuations.
Timing Your Creatine Intake
Decades of debate about pre-workout versus post-workout creatine timing have produced a clear answer: it does not matter significantly. Consistency matters far more than timing. Taking creatine at the same time daily, whether morning, pre-workout, or post-workout, produces equivalent results.
Some research suggests taking creatine with carbohydrates may enhance absorption slightly, but the difference is marginal. What matters most is taking it daily, including rest days, to maintain muscle saturation.
Identifying Non-Responders
Approximately 20-30% of the population are creatine non-responders, meaning they experience minimal benefits from supplementation. These individuals typically have naturally high muscle creatine stores from diet or genetics. Testing your response requires consistent use for at least 4-6 weeks while tracking strength and body composition changes.
If you see no improvements in strength, recovery, or muscle fullness after six weeks of daily 5g dosing, you may be a non-responder. Discontinuing supplementation is reasonable in this case, as continuing provides no benefit.

Why did I gain weight after taking creatine?
Initial weight gain from creatine is primarily water retention in muscle cells, not fat gain. Creatine pulls water into muscle tissue, increasing cell volume and scale weight by 2-5 pounds within the first week. This is temporary and actually supports muscle growth by creating a more anabolic cellular environment.
Do I need to load creatine for muscle building?
Loading creatine is optional. Taking 20g daily for 5-7 days saturates muscles faster, but taking the standard 5g maintenance dose achieves the same results within 3-4 weeks with fewer side effects. For most users, skipping the loading phase and taking 5g daily is the optimal approach.
Is creatine safe for long-term muscle building use?
Creatine is one of the most researched supplements with over 30 years of safety data supporting long-term daily use at 5g doses. No adverse health effects have been documented in healthy individuals, and it may provide cognitive and bone health benefits beyond muscle building.
